Gregory Finnegan hopes Hollyoaks fans will return after success

Gregory Finnegan is hoping some former ‘Hollyoaks’ viewers will return to the soap follow its recent success.
The Channel 4 show scooped Best Soap at the British Soap Awards and the Inside Soap Awards this year, and the 39-year-old star – who plays James Nightingale – is delighted the programme has been recognised.
He told BANG Showbiz: "It’s been a good year. It’s been surprising, I think for everyone concerned.
"We felt like we’d had a good year but for that to be recognised at various award shows is great.
"We’ve lost out a lot of times, so to start winning a few is lovely.
"I hope they’re coming back, if they did leave the show at any point, and seeing that we are doing good work that is up there with all the other soaps.
"It’s not just a 6.30pm kids show. It can be for everyone.
"We’re at top of our game and hopefully that will continue."
Jennifer Metcalfe – who plays Mercedes McQueen – also admitted she is "proud" of the soap’s recent success.
She added: "I remember going to soap awards three or four years ago and everyone is like, ‘This is our year, this is our year.’
"I always thought, ‘Yeah, we’re good, we’re good.’
"But honestly, right now, I believe in the show so much. Not that I didn’t before.
"It’s vibrant, it’s young, it’s very current. Our soap looks different, and I like the way it looks.
"It’s something I’m proud to be a part of, and I think it’s very fitting and very right that we’ve been recognised this year."
Gregory’s latest big storyline has seen his character James named as one of the seven suspects in the Who Shot Mercedes whodunit after Mercedes was gunned down in The Loft.
But the star recently admitted he didn’t even realise his alter-ego was going to be a part of the plot until he was called to do a promo photoshoot.
He said: "We got called in to do a photoshoot and I didn’t know what it was for.
"So I was like, ‘What’s all this?’ They said, ‘It’s for the Who Shot Mercedes story,’ and I was like, ‘Oh, great, OK. Am I part of that then?’
"I had a meeting with Bryan the next day and he spelled out what my involvement would be.
"We all got pulled in individually because he wanted to keep the circle tight, so it doesn’t get revealed before it has to."
